usual
ˈjuːʒʊəl/
adjective
adjective: usual
  1. 1.
    habitually or typically occurring or done; customary.
    “he carried out his usual evening routine”
noun
noun: usual; plural noun: usuals
  1. 1.
    the thing which is typically done or present.
    “the band was a bit sick of playing all the usuals”
    • informal
      the drink one habitually prefers.
      “‘My usual, please,’ she said to the barman”
Origin
late Middle English: from Old French, or from late Latin usualis, from Latin usus ‘a use’ (see use).
